Diamond City in Fallout 4 is the largest and safest settlement. The city was founded on the stands of the Fenway Park baseball stadium, and received its name because of the stadium's nickname, “the great green gem,” which in turn was derived from the color of everything inside it.

It accommodates a huge number of inhabitants, lighting, a pond, vegetable gardens, bars and many merchants. Here you can also find a church, a school, the Valentine Detective Agency and several bars.

Important Features

  • When you finish the game, flags of the organization you joined will be planted throughout the city, and its fighters will begin patrolling;
  • If you enter the game on December 25, there will be trees and garlands everywhere, and you will be wished a Merry Christmas, just as if you visit the game on October 31, the city will be decorated with pumpkins, and some characters will give out Halloween themed phrases;
  • You can get to the top of the walls of Diamond City, where a couple of caches and secrets are hidden, from the nearest building using a propeller or a jetpack;
  • If you visit a church of all faiths and pray, you can get an ability that increases experience by 5% for 8 hours - and you can do this an infinite number of times;

Tango three

Go to Diamond City and go up. Head to a place called Colonial Taphouse. Inside you will hear an argument between a husband (Paul Pembroke) and wife (Darcy Pembroke). Paul will also fight Henry Cook, a bartender. Talk to Darcy and Henry. Go outside and chat with Paul. He will ask you to scare Henry. You can either agree to help him or refuse.

If you agree to help, Cook will kill Paul before you arrive. It's best to go alone. Convince Paul of this and rise on your own. Talk to Cook. You can win a fight or use charisma and resolve the issue peacefully.

If the conversation ends peacefully, Cook will tell you about the deal he was involved in. If you kill Cook, you can search his body and still learn about the deal.

Deal

The deal was made with a bandit named Nelson Latimer. You must go to his hideout. Go north to the river west of the Back Street ramp. Here you will find Nelson and his men. No matter what you do, the meeting will end in a shootout. Talk to the only survivor of the massacre, who is Nelson's supplier named Trish. You can either leave her alive, or promise her, but then still kill her.

In any case, you will be able to obtain information about the location of the laboratory. It's usually best to arrange to go there with Trish, since she has the password to the lab terminal. If Cook came with you, he will kill Trish when she tries to escape. So be prepared for this. You'll hear about Marowski.

If Paul is still involved in all this, then he will want you to share the spoils with him. A high level of charisma will allow you to achieve a 70/30 percent split in your favor. Unfortunately, without killing Paul, it is impossible to take all the caps for yourself. If Paul is still in quarantine, but you spoke with Cook alone and Paul was never present with you, you can inform him of Cook's fate and say goodbye, keeping all the loot for yourself.

Regardless, you will have to travel to Boston to find the Quatrefoil Fish Factory. There will be a huge concentration of ghouls here, so be on your guard. Instead of going into the factory, go up to the upper walkway and climb onto the roof. There is a terminal on the wall where you need to enter the password you received from Trish. Use it to get inside the laboratory. You will encounter Marowski's men who will need to be killed.

After the quest. Marowski's position

If you let Trish or Nelson leave, Marowski will contact you within 24 hours. He wants you to meet him at the Rexford Hotel in Goodnaigbore. You can ignore his request, but as a result of this, Marowski's bandits will constantly pursue you.

Meet with Marowski as he requests. He will demand that you pay 2000 caps for the damage caused. You can convince him that the fee should be reduced to 1000 caps. After which you can either pay the compensation amount, or ask for a week to collect this money, or show Marovsky a photograph that you could have received from Darcy.

Main base in Diamond City Fallout 4 will be an excellent place to take a break between your travels, as well as modify weapons and stock up on necessary goods from merchants. This location is also good for those who don’t want to bother with their own settlement. This convenience is ensured by the fact that this city is the safest settlement in the Wasteland. It is located inside the former Fenway Park stadium and is well protected on all sides.

Where to begin

In order to get your Home Base, you will first need to buy a house in Diamond City. The secretary of the local mayor named Geneva will help with this, and this pleasure costs 2000 caps. After making a valuable purchase, the key to your own house will appear in your inventory, you can enter it and begin improving your home.

Home improvement

Initially, your home looks more like a junkyard than the home of a self-respecting adventurer. Garbage, broken furniture and other rubbish are strewn everywhere. But this situation can be easily corrected. You have two floors at your disposal, as well as a roof which can be accessed through a special hatch and the interior of all rooms of the house can be changed to your liking. To do this, you just need to go into construction mode, buy furniture, decorations, arrange lighting fixtures and even workbenches. The interface is no different from the one used when building a settlement.

Features of the Main Base

Although the Main Base is somewhat similar to ordinary settlements in the game, it still has some of its own features:

  • It is impossible to establish trade routes between the Main Base and other settlements, so collecting and storing building materials here would not be a good idea.
  • You can teleport to the Main Base using fast travel, which makes it a very convenient place. You can also leave this location by using fast travel.
  • You will not be able to send your inactive companions here. However, you cannot send them to other settlements either.

In order to begin the quest “The Pearl of the Commonwealth”, you will first have to meet Preston Garvey, a Minuteman of the Commonwealth. Start the quest “Call of Freedom”, it will be activated as soon as you approach the Museum of Freedom in Concourt, where the previous quest “Time is Running Out” was completed. Help Preston Garvey and his people, clear the territory of Concord from enemies. When the job is completed, Mother Murphy, one of Harvey's people, will tell you that she feels that your son is still alive, and will suggest starting his search from the largest settlement in the area - Diamond City.

Get to Diamond City

The journey to get there will be very long, as you may meet anyone along the way! Raiders, super mutants, angry wild animals and God knows who else. Be careful! But on the other hand, such a long journey through the Wasteland will allow you to get acquainted with the new world and its inhabitants.

As you cross the Broken Boston Bridge, look for signs pointing towards Diamond City.

At the entrance you will encounter a reporter named Piper. She will help you get inside the closed city by deceiving the guard.


Get information about Sean

At the entrance, you will witness a small squabble between the mayor of the city, McDonagh and Piper.

After talking with him, you will find out his thoughts about Piper. By the way, in the future she may become your companion. Full list of companions.

Charisma

Do you want to feel the power? Talk to the mayor about his situation with Piper, and at the same time test your charisma skills. Suddenly you learn something interesting. And in general, this skill will be useful to you with other residents of the city.

Then head to the Diamond City Market, where you'll find people to talk to and ask around.

Who can help you in this busy market? Most people are quite friendly. You can ask the following people to help you figure out what to do next:

  • Denny Sullivan, guard at the entrance to the city.
  • Pastor Clements at Church of All Faiths.
  • Nat, Piper's younger sister, who sells the Social Events newspaper.
  • Piper will only help you after you give her an interview.
  • Moe Cronin, Flyboy bit salesman extraordinaire.
  • John, hairdresser.
  • Arturo Rodriguez, arms dealer.

Some of them will advise you to contact the detective agency Nick Valentine, located right there in Diamond City.

Easter egg

Going deeper into the agency, you will find one very interesting secret case of Nick Valentine about the Mysterious Stranger, who has been appearing throughout the former United States for many years. This is a reference to past Fallout installments, in which a mysterious stranger also appeared. In Fallout 4, he is also waiting for us - the Mysterious Stranger perk will allow you to take a look at him. Who knows, maybe we'll learn a little more about him?

Help: Big boy


Peculiarity: Fires an additional projectile

Damage: 486

Ammunition: Nuclear minicharge

Rate of fire: 1

Range: 117

Accuracy: 39

Weight: 30,7

Price: 13 783

Installed: Standard launch projectile

Description: Used to launch a devastating mini-nuclear blast, Big Boy boasts unrivaled damage output. Once launched, the mini-nuclear charge quickly loses altitude, so aim just above your target or use V.A.T.S. mode to make an accurate shot. In any case, make sure that you are at a safe distance from your target - the mini-nuclear charge has a considerable radius of destruction.
